Sabrina Carpenter - 10 things to know with detail
  • Sabrina Carpenter is an American singer, songwriter, and actress who first gained fame for her role as Maya Hart on the Disney Channel series "Girl Meets World."
  • She was born on May 11, 1999, in Lehigh Valley, Pennsylvania.
  • Sabrina released her debut studio album, "Eyes Wide Open," in 2015, which featured the hit single "Can't Blame a Girl for Trying."
  • She has since released two more albums, "Evolution" in 2016 and "Singular: Act I" in 2018, as well as an EP titled "Singular: Act II" in 2019.
  • Sabrina has also appeared in several movies, including "The Hate U Give" and "Tall Girl," as well as lending her voice to the animated film "Clouds."
  • She has won several awards for her music, including Radio Disney Music Awards and Teen Choice Awards.
  • Sabrina is known for her powerful vocals and catchy pop songs, often drawing inspiration from her own experiences and emotions.
  • She has a strong presence on social media, with millions of followers on platforms like Instagram and Twitter.
  • In addition to her music and acting career, Sabrina is also a philanthropist, supporting causes such as anti-bullying initiatives and mental health awareness.
